logo

Output 8f62a95a86d4d50d5b70f15e394efebada09552fbc5d6d153f369f38a7d8eb44:1

value
597499013
script pubkey
OP_0 OP_PUSHBYTES_20 96e25cb06a7d14357b194bac0d000c76e42fe6cc
address
bc1qjm39evr2052r27cefwkq6qqvwmjzlekv0qcc3t
transaction
8f62a95a86d4d50d5b70f15e394efebada09552fbc5d6d153f369f38a7d8eb44